Parkinson’s disease is a progressive neurological disorder that mainly affects movement. It develops when nerve cells responsible for producing dopamine gradually become damaged or stop working properly. Common symptoms include tremors, stiffness, slow movement, balance problems, and changes in speech. Although there is no permanent cure, modern drugs for parkinson's disease help manage symptoms effectively, allowing many people to maintain their daily routines and improve their quality of life.


Treatment plans vary from one person to another depending on age, symptom severity, overall health, and disease progression. Doctors often adjust medications over time to ensure the best possible symptom control.



How Modern Medications Help


The primary goal of Parkinson’s medications is to restore or improve dopamine activity in the brain. Since Parkinson’s disease develops due to reduced dopamine production, these medications help improve communication between brain cells responsible for controlling movement.


The right combination of drugs used to treat parkinson's disease can reduce tremors, improve muscle control, minimize stiffness, and support better coordination. Early diagnosis and regular medical monitoring play an important role in achieving the best treatment outcomes.


Common Drugs for Parkinson's Disease


Several medication groups are available to manage Parkinson’s disease symptoms. Doctors select the most suitable option based on individual needs.


Levodopa and Carbidopa


Levodopa remains one of the most effective drugs for parkinson's disease. Once inside the brain, levodopa converts into dopamine, helping improve movement. It is commonly combined with carbidopa, which prevents the medication from breaking down before reaching the brain and reduces side effects such as nausea.


Dopamine Agonists


These medications imitate dopamine by directly stimulating dopamine receptors. Dopamine agonists are often prescribed during the early stages of Parkinson’s disease or alongside levodopa to improve symptom control. While effective, they may occasionally cause dizziness, sleepiness, or hallucinations in some patients.


MAO-B Inhibitors


Monoamine oxidase-B inhibitors slow the breakdown of dopamine in the brain. By preserving natural dopamine levels, these medications help improve movement and may delay the need for higher doses of levodopa in certain patients.


COMT Inhibitors


Catechol-O-methyltransferase inhibitors are generally prescribed with levodopa. They extend the effect of levodopa by slowing its breakdown, helping reduce fluctuations in symptom control throughout the day.


Amantadine


Amantadine may be recommended to reduce involuntary movements caused by long-term levodopa use. It can also provide mild relief from Parkinson’s symptoms during the early stages of the disease.


Anticholinergic Medications


Although prescribed less frequently today, these medicines may help younger patients manage tremors when other symptoms remain mild.


Managing Medication Side Effects


Like all medications, drugs used to treat parkinson's disease may cause side effects. Some people experience nausea, dizziness, low blood pressure, sleep disturbances, or involuntary movements after prolonged treatment.

Regular follow-up appointments allow healthcare providers to adjust medication timing, dosage, or combinations to reduce unwanted effects while maintaining symptom control. Patients should never stop taking Parkinson’s medications without consulting their doctor.


Lifestyle Support Alongside Medication


Medication works best when combined with healthy lifestyle habits. Physical therapy helps improve balance and mobility, while occupational therapy supports everyday activities. Speech therapy can assist with communication and swallowing difficulties. Regular exercise, balanced nutrition, and sufficient sleep also contribute to better overall symptom management.


Because Parkinson’s disease changes over time, treatment plans often require periodic adjustments to address new symptoms and maintain independence.

Frequently Asked Questions


1. What are the most commonly prescribed drugs for Parkinson's disease?


Levodopa combined with carbidopa is the most commonly prescribed medication. Other options include dopamine agonists, MAO-B inhibitors, COMT inhibitors, amantadine, and anticholinergic medications depending on individual needs.


2. Can drugs used to treat Parkinson's disease cure the condition?


No. Drugs used to treat parkinson's disease cannot cure Parkinson’s disease, but they can effectively manage symptoms, improve movement, and help patients maintain daily activities.


3. How long do Parkinson’s medications remain effective?


The effectiveness varies for each person. Many patients benefit from medications for several years, although treatment plans often require dosage adjustments or additional therapies as the disease progresses.
